Abstract
The invention belongs to the wire and cable technical field and relates to a connector for fast wire connection and a connection method of the connector. According to the technical schemes of the invention, the connector with breakout type connecting terminals is provided; the connector with the breakout type connecting terminals includes wires and a connector; the connector comprises a base and an upper cover; the connecting terminals and wire slot cavities are arranged in the base; each connecting terminal comprises a connecting terminal body composed of a terminal front segment and a terminal rear segment, wherein the terminal front segment a flat body and is provided with a deep rectangular narrow groove of the width is equal to the diameter of the copper core wires of the wires and of which the opening is horn-shaped and expands outwards, and the terminal rear segment is a bunching buckle. With the connector provided by the technical schemes of the invention adopted, the wires can be clamped into the slot cavities in the base, and are subjected to stamping, and therefore, the insulation sheaths of the connected wires are cut by the openings of the rectangular narrow grooves of the connecting terminals, so that the edges of the rectangular narrow grooves can be connected with the copper core lines of the connected wires, and an upper cover is buckled. With the connector adopted, solid connection can be realized, and work efficiency can be greatly improved.

Background technology
The existing connection terminal for electric wire, one is to be cut away by electric wire insulation layer with cutter, makes terminal leading portion connect and is connected wires, then welds, the wiring in succession of the back segment of terminal;This mode needs manually to be operated completely, and production efficiency is extremely low, and junction point is easy to fall off, and quality of connection is poor, and stability is not high.
Another kind is the connection terminal of needle-penetrating, is thrust by connection terminal and is connected wires in insulating barrier;Although this mode production efficiency improves than former mode, but still inefficient.And connect and differ with electric wire inner core contact area when terminal thrusts, quality of connection is unstable.
